Anyone with Long Tubes & Starter Heat Sink?
I am running Long Tubes & after I run the car for awhile the starter is really struggling. It gets super heat soaked from the headers. I am getting a starter heat "Bag" to see if it helps this situation but I was just wondering how many of you had a problem like this.
